Strengths based organizations sbos capitalize on these positive outcomes by systematically selecting employees based on talent, positioning them to use their strengths every day, and integrating strengths into key processes and systems organizationwide. Strengths based leadership includes a section that lists all 34 cliftonstrengths themes of talent, as well as strategies for how to apply each theme to meet your followers needs and tips for leading others based on their top themes you can use these strategies, paired with firsthand accounts from some of the most successful organizational leaders in recent history, to build your own.
